Abigail’s voice was crisp and clear, and her eyes were determined, but after
she said those words, Sean’s phone started ringing. He immediately whisked
out his cell phone, checked the caller ID, and frowned in concern before
picking up. “What happened?”
She couldn’t hear what the person on the phone said, but he replied, “I’ll be
right there.” Then, he left the bedroom without even so much as a glance at
Abigail.
A snort escaped her lips, but she said nothing as she decided to forgo sleep
for tonight. Then, she packed her stuff, printed out the divorce agreement,
and swiftly signed her name. Then, she placed them on the coffee table in
the living room along with a few cards and left their marital home.
Luna crossed her long legs as she leaned casually against the hood of the
car and straightened herself. Her eyes almost popped out of their sockets in
surprise when she saw Abigail coming with just a tiny piece of luggage. “Are
you serious? That’s all of your belongings?”

Abigail deftly placed her luggage into the car trunk and climbed into the
driver’s seat. “All those are unnecessary things. At least, I’m free now,” she
declared, pretending to be relaxed.
2/8
“Did you really divorce him?”
Luna still sounded doubtful, but Abigail shrugged nonchalantly. “I’m done with
love and finally going to live my own life now.”
Luna didn’t question Abigail further. Instead, she turned the steering wheel
and cursed, “Damn it. Sean Graham is so rich. You should at least get a few
hundred million in assets for the divorce!”
Abigail pursed her lips indifferently. “His empire is his asset before marriage,
and I have no interest in coveting that.”
